LDF Hedge Fund Activity: Q3 2017 in Review

19 of the 4,011 institutional investors tracked by Wall St. Rank reported a position in Latin American Discovery Fund (LDF) for Q3 2017, worth a combined $47M — up 13% from $41.5M a quarter earlier.

Sellers outnumbered buyers: 4 funds closed out of LDF and 2 opened new positions — a net loss of 2 holders — while 5 trimmed existing stakes and 10 added.

The largest buyer was Matisse Capital, adding an estimated $1.02M. The largest seller was Amica Mutual Insurance, exiting entirely with an estimated $1.81M sold.
